There isn't any consequence to bringing Thousands Sons since they don't have a legion trait to lose yet. You are correct.

 

I'm not very familiar with summoning since I don't use it; but my understanding is that any chaos character can summon, so if the Exalted Flamers have the "character" keyword they should be able to summon.
